BAKALA v. BAKALA

No. 2D10-4381.

58 So.3d 423 (2011)

Mathew BAKALA, Appellant, v. Dorothy BAKALA,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Second District.

April 15, 2011.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Douglas R. Bald of Fergeson, Skipper, Shaw, Keyser, Baron & Tirabassi, P.A., Sarasota, for Appellant.

Walter E. Smith of Meros, Smith, Lazzara & Olney, P.A., St. Petersburg, for Appellee.


KELLY, Judge.

Mathew Bakala appeals from the order dismissing his lawsuit for failure to prosecute. We reverse because record activity occurred in the case within sixty days after the notice of lack of prosecution was served, thus precluding dismissal under Florida Rule of Civil Procedure 1.420(e).
